George S. McWatters

1 books

George S. McWatters was an American author known for his work in the detective fiction genre. His notable book, "Knots Untied; Or, Ways and By-ways in the Hidden Life of American Detectives," explores the intricacies and challenges faced by detectives in the United States. Through a blend of narrative and insight, McWatters provides readers with a glimpse into the hidden aspects of detective work, contributing to the literary landscape of crime and mystery in his time. His writing reflects the evolving nature of American detective stories, making him a noteworthy figure in the genre.
